Understanding ED and the Importance of Improving Erectile Function


Erectile dysfunction affects millions of men worldwide, impacting self-esteem and relationships. It's defined as the inability to achieve or maintain an erection sufficient for sexual performance. Understanding the causes of ED is crucial; it can stem from psychological issues, medical conditions, or lifestyle choices.


Statistics show that around 150 million men are affected globally by erectile dysfunction. This figure is expected to reach 322 million by 2025. The good news is that there are various strategies for improving erectile function. By addressing the root causes and making conscious changes, you can enhance your sexual health and overall quality of life.

Lifestyle Changes for Better Erectile Health


Making specific lifestyle changes has proven to be one of the most effective methods for improving erectile function. Here are some actionable steps you can take:


1. Maintain a Healthy Diet


A balanced diet plays a significant role in your overall health and erectile function. Foods rich in v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ants can boost blood flow and improve erectile performance. Focus on:


  • Fruits like bananas and berries

  • Vegetables, especially leafy greens

  • Nuts and seeds, which contain healthy fats

  • Lean proteins such as chicken and fish


Avoid foods high in saturated fats, as they can reduce blood circulation. Studies have shown that a Mediterranean diet, rich in fresh produce, whole grains, and healthy fats such as olive oil, is particularly beneficial for erectile health.


2. Incorporate Regular Exercise


Exercise not only improves circulation but also increases testosterone levels, which can boost sex drive and erectile function.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week. Effective exercises include:


  • Walking or jogging

  • Cycling

  • Swimming

  • Strength training


Even 30 minutes of activity several times a week can make a difference in your erectile function. Regular exercise improves cardiovascular health, which is crucial for maintaining erections.

3. Quit Smoking and Limit Alcohol Consumption


Smoking has a detrimental effect on blood flow and can contribute to erectile dysfunction. Research shows that smokers are twice as likely to experience ED compared to non-smokers. Quitting smoking can significantly improve erectile health.


Similarly, excessive alcohol consumption can lead to ED. While moderate drinking may be harmless for some, heavy drinking can lead to nerve damage and hormone imbalances. Limit your intake to no more than one drink per day.


Have Morning Wood but Still Have ED?


Many men experience morning erections, commonly referred to as “morning wood.” This phenomenon occurs when the body goes through REM sleep, leading to increased blood flow to the penis. However, if you experience morning wood but still struggle with erectile dysfunction during sexual activity, the issue might be tied to psychological factors or other medical conditions.


It's essential to discuss this with a healthcare provider, who can help you determine if your erectile dysfunction is linked to mental health issues such as anxiety or depression. Therapies such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) or counseling can be effective.


4. Manage Stress and Mental Health


Mental health has a direct correlation with erectile function. Stress, anxiety, and depression can hinder your ability to perform. Practicing relaxation techniques can help alleviate stress and improve your sexual performance. Consider:


  • Meditation

  • Deep breathing exercises

  • Yoga

  • Relaxation techniques such as progressive muscle relaxation


Taking care of your mental state can be just as important as focusing on physical health when it comes to enhancing erectile function.

Medical Treatments for Erectile Dysfunction


If lifestyle changes do not yield the desired improvements in erectile function, medical treatments may be required. Here are some options to consider:


5. Prescription Medications


Several medications are available to help improve erectile function:


  • Sildenafil (Viagra) – Works by increasing blood flow to the penis during sexual arousal.

  • Tadalafil (Cialis) – Known for its longer duration, it can be taken daily or on an as-needed basis.

  • Vardenafil (Levitra) – Similar to Viagra, this medication enhances blood flow.


Consult with a healthcare provider for a prescription and to discuss potential side effects and interactions with other medications.


6. Vacuum Erection Devices


These devices create a vacuum around the penis, stimulating blood flow and creating an erection. While they can be effective for some men, they may require practice to use properly.


7. Penile Implants


In severe cases of erectile dysfunction that do not respond to other treatments, penile implants may be an option. This surgical procedure involves placing devices into both sides of the penis, allowing for spontaneous erections.


It's essential to discuss all treatment options with a qualified healthcare provider, who can guide you toward the best approach based on your individual needs.
